Navigating the Future of Network Security: Trends to Watch in 2024

The year 2024 is just around the corner, and with it comes a host of changes in the landscape of network security. As cyber threats become more sophisticated, businesses must adapt their strategies to protect sensitive data and maintain a secure digital environment. In this article, we will explore the key trends that are expected to shape network security in 2024.

1. Rise of AI and Machine Learning in Security Protocols

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) are revolutionizing network security. These technologies enable automated responses to threats, allowing for real-time detection and mitigation of attacks. Enterprises are increasingly integrating AI-driven solutions into their security frameworks to enhance their defenses.

2. Increased Focus on Zero Trust Architecture

The traditional perimeter-based security model is becoming obsolete. Organizations are shifting towards a Zero Trust Architecture (ZTA), which assumes that threats can be internal or external. ZTA requires continuous verification of users and devices, thus enhancing overall security posture.

3. Cloud Security Takes Center Stage

As more enterprises migrate to the cloud, cloud security is paramount. Security solutions must evolve to protect data stored in cloud environments. This includes adopting advanced encryption techniques and implementing strict access controls.

4. Regulatory Compliance and Data Privacy

With the enactment of various data protection laws globally, businesses must prioritize compliance. Organizations need to stay updated on regulations such as GDPR and CCPA, ensuring that their network security measures align with these legal frameworks.

5. Cybersecurity Skills Gap Continues

The demand for cybersecurity professionals far exceeds supply, leading to a skills gap. Organizations must invest in training and development programs to cultivate a workforce capable of tackling emerging security challenges.

In conclusion, as we look towards 2024, staying informed about these network security trends is essential for enterprises. By leveraging advanced technologies and adopting a proactive approach, businesses can enhance their security measures and protect their critical data.
